Neville Framing Art Gallery & Poster Shoppe Ltd offers Art Galleries services in St. John's, NL area. To get more details you can call us on (709) 753-2914.
Reviews
There are no reviews for Neville Framing Art Gallery & Poster Shoppe Ltd.
Write a review now.